Yvette, I do not believe that the agent is charging you $500 to pull listings. Listings are available on the internet for all to search although our listing service provides the most up to date information. You mentioned that you can pull your own listings and you need an agent to provide advise...and that she had not driven your around yet.

That advise does not come free... don't you think that her expertise that you want her to share with you should be compensated?

A retainer fee is just that... a fee paid to retain a professional so that she can do all the things you would like her to. - Tue Sep 8 2009, 19:17
